genU is seeking a confident, proactive, and people-focused Team Leader – Operations Support to play a vital role in delivering high-quality administrative support across our Disability & Ageing Division.
As a leader in our Client Services Team you'll drive clarity, structure, and high performance across teams based in Tasmania and Victoria. Your focus will be on delivering consistent, efficient operational services that directly enable our frontline teams to achieve outstanding results for clients.
What you'll do
As a Team Leader – Operations Support in our Client Services Team, you'll:
- Lead and support a dynamic operations team across VIC and TAS, promoting a collaborative, inclusive, and high-performing team culture.
- Oversee day-to-day administrative operations, ensuring timely and consistent delivery of services such as reception, data entry, document management, fleet coordination, and financial transactions.
- Drive continuous improvement, supporting the implementation of streamlined, standardised processes that enhance service delivery and reduce inefficiencies across multiple sites.
- Monitor team performance, allocate resources effectively, and ensure alignment with genU policies, service standards, and strategic objectives.
- Partner with stakeholders across the Disability & Ageing Division and wider genU network to enable smooth, values-driven operational support.
What you'll bring
- A qualification in Business Admin, Management, or a related field, or relevant leadership experience
- Proven ability to manage distributed teams and deliver high-quality operational outcomes
- Strong organisational and time-management skills, with the ability to juggle multiple priorities
- Excellent interpersonal and communication skills
- Confidence using Microsoft Office (especially Teams, Excel, Outlook) and working with digital systems
(You'll also need a Working With Children Check, NDIS Worker Screening Check and Orientation Module Certificate – but don't worry, we'll help guide you through this.)
Bonus points for
- Experience working with people with disability or within the community services sector.
- Familiarity with CareLink, Lumary, or other CRM systems.
- An understanding of the NDIS and broader disability service landscape.
